Hunte's Gardens is really beautiful. A massive, collapsed cave has been converted into an ornately designed garden. The owner, Anthony Hunte, likes to interact with visitors over refreshments (rum punch anyone?) but that's an optional "extra". I'm not sure children would find the experience all that interesting though.

The largest and only complete sugar windmill surviving in the Caribbean. Maybe of more interest to history buffs and not so exciting for children but, at least, you can gat snacks and eats after the tour and it is beautiful up there
